Transaction 62ca0862d756ad7e497727b6df217ceb01d1b5299a4666a1c9a36aba64c71691
3 Input
2 Outputs
- 62ca0862d756ad7e497727b6df217ceb01d1b5299a4666a1c9a36aba64c71691:0
- 62ca0862d756ad7e497727b6df217ceb01d1b5299a4666a1c9a36aba64c71691:1
value 923283
address 139vfwfb5TpiEHZ6LaAfQSK3c5UWcG5GpD
value 2564508
address 1C6yitvEbTcWJ9dLP7PEcatUgdZHm4zvAN